body {left: 0px;top:0px;margin-left: 0px;margin-top: 0px;background: #000;}

#page {clear:both;margin: 0 auto 0 auto;width:765px;}

.header{position:relative;float:left; width:765px;height:136px;background: url(images/header_home.jpg) top no-repeat;}
.header_sweet{position:relative;float:left; width:765px;height:136px;background: url(images/header_sweet.jpg) top no-repeat;}

.title_home{position:relative;float:left; width:765px;height:70px;background: url(images/title_home.jpg) top no-repeat;}
.title_savoury{position:relative;float:left; width:765px;height:70px;background: url(images/title_savoury.jpg) top no-repeat;}
.title_sweet{position:relative;float:left; width:765px;height:70px;background: url(images/title_sweet.jpg) top no-repeat;}

.title_about{position:relative;float:left; width:765px;height:70px;background: url(images/title_about.jpg) top no-repeat;}
.title_awards{position:relative;float:left; width:765px;height:70px;background: url(images/title_awards.jpg) top no-repeat;}
.title_hampers{position:relative;float:left; width:765px;height:70px;background: url(images/title_hampers.jpg) top no-repeat;}
.title_news{position:relative;float:left; width:765px;height:70px;background: url(images/title_news.jpg) top no-repeat;}
.title_offers{position:relative;float:left; width:765px;height:70px;background: url(images/title_offers.jpg) top no-repeat;}
.title_recipes{position:relative;float:left; width:765px;height:70px;background: url(images/title_recipes.jpg) top no-repeat;}
.title_stockists{position:relative;float:left; width:765px;height:70px;background: url(images/title_stockists.jpg) top no-repeat;}
.title_trade{position:relative;float:left; width:765px;height:70px;background: url(images/title_trade.jpg) top no-repeat;}
.title_contact{position:relative;float:left; width:765px;height:70px;background: url(images/title_contact.jpg) top no-repeat;}

.menu_drop{position:relative;width:765px;float:left;z-index:1005987;}

.menu{position:relative;width:765px;float:left;font-family:arial;height:28px;color:#fff;}
.menu a{text-decoration:none; color:#fff;padding-left:1px;padding-right:10px;font-weight:bold;font-size:11px;line-height:28px;}
.menu a:hover{text-decoration:underline; color:#cf003c;}
.menu_clicked{text-decoration:underline; color:#cf003c;padding-left:1px;padding-right:10px;font-weight:bold;font-size:11px;line-height:28px;}

.menu_sweet{position:relative;width:765px;float:left;font-family:arial;height:28px;background-image: url(images/menu_sweet.jpg); background-position: right top; background-repeat: no-repeat;background-color:#000;}
.menu_sweet a{text-decoration:none; color:#fff;padding-left:1px;padding-right:10px;font-weight:bold;font-size:11px;line-height:28px;}
.menu_sweet a:hover{text-decoration:underline; color:#cf003c;}
.menu_sweet_clicked{text-decoration:underline; color:#cf003c;padding-left:1px;padding-right:10px;font-weight:bold;font-size:11px;line-height:28px;}

.content{position:relative;clear:both;width:765px;float:left;font-family:arial;font-size:12px;color:#000;background:#f4e6ce;}
.content a{color:#cf003c;text-decoration:underline;}
.content a:hover{color:#000;text-decoration:underline;}
.content h2{color:#cf003c;font-size:18px;padding-left:5px;padding-right:5px;}

.home_div_1{position:relative;width:283px;padding-left:3px;height:200px;float:left;background-color:#f4e6ce;border-right: 1px solid #c3b8a5;border-bottom: 1px solid #c3b8a5;color:#000;background-image: url(images/pic1.jpg);background-repeat: no-repeat;background-position: bottom right;}
.home_div_1 a{font-weight:bold;text-decoration:none; color:#000;}
.home_div_1 a:hover{font-weight:bold;text-decoration:underline; color:#cf003c;}
.home_div_1 h1{font-size:16px;text-align:center;font-weight:bold; font-family: gill sans;}

.home_div_2{position:relative;width:207px;height:200px;padding-left:3px;float:left;color:#000;background-color:#f6ebd8;border-bottom: 1px solid #c3b8a5;background-image: url(images/pic2_new.jpg);background-repeat: no-repeat;background-position: 89% 65%;}
.home_div_2 h1{font-size:16px;text-align:center;font-weight:bold; font-family: gill sans;color:#cf003c;}
.home_div_2 a{font-weight:bold;text-decoration:none; color:#000;}
.home_div_2 a:hover{font-weight:bold;text-decoration:underline; color:#cf003c;}

.home_div_3{position:relative;width:268px;height:200px;float:left;border-bottom: 1px solid #c3b8a5;background: url(images/pic3.jpg) top no-repeat;}

.home_div_4{position:relative;width:286px;height:220px;float:left;background-color:#f6ebd8;border-right: 1px solid #c3b8a5;background-image: url(images/CMC01-Cheese-Straws_b.png);background-repeat: no-repeat;background-position: bottom left;}
.home_div_4 h1{font-size:16px;text-align:center;font-weight:bold; font-family: gill sans;color:#cf003c;}
.home_div_4 a:hover{font-weight:bold;text-decoration:underline; color:#cf003c;}
.home_div_4 a{font-weight:bold;text-decoration:none; color:#000;}


.home_div_5{position:relative;width:207px;text-align:right;padding-right:3px;color:#000;height:220px;float:left;background-color:#f4e6ce;border-right: 1px solid #c3b8a5;background-image: url(images/pic5.jpg);background-repeat: no-repeat;background-position: left bottom;overflow:hidden;}
.home_div_5 h1{font-size:16px;text-align:center;font-weight:bold; font-family: gill sans;color:#000;}
.home_div_5 a:hover{font-weight:bold;text-decoration:underline; color:#cf003c;}
.home_div_5 a{font-weight:bold;text-decoration:none; color:#000;}

.home_div_6{position:relative;width:264px;padding-left:3px;height:220px;float:left;background-color:#f6ebd8;background-image: url(images/pic6.jpg);background-repeat: no-repeat;background-position: right bottom;color:#000;}
.home_div_6 h1{font-size:16px;text-align:center;font-weight:bold; font-family: gill sans;color:#000;}
.home_div_6 a:hover{font-weight:bold;text-decoration:underline; color:#cf003c;}
.home_div_6 a{font-weight:bold;text-decoration:none; color:#000;}

.pic1{float:right;padding-top:17px;}

.pic2{float:right;margin-top:45px;}

.pic4{float:left;margin-top:15px;}
* html .pic4{border:0px solid green;position:relative;margin-bottom:-19px;height:167px;}

.pic5{float:left;margin-top:98px;}

.pic6{float:right;margin-top:79px;}

.footer_home{position:relative;width:765px;height:16px;clear:both;float:left;font-family:times;font-size:12px;color:#fff;text-align:center;background: url(images/footer_home.jpg) no-repeat transparent;border: 0px solid green;}
.footer_home a:hover{color:#cf003c;}
.footer_home a{color:#fff;}

.footer{position:relative;width:765px;height:16px;clear:both;float:left;font-family:times;font-size:12px;color:#fff;text-align:center;background: #000;border: 0px solid green;}
.footer a:hover{color:#cf003c;}
.footer a{color:#fff;}

#drop_menu_products{position:absolute;z-index:100;top:28px;left:90px;background: #000;width:150px;font-weight:bold;font-family:arial;font-size:11px;display:none;}
#drop_menu_products a{color:#fff;padding-left:10px;line-height:25px;text-decoration:none;}
#drop_menu_products a:hover{color:#cf003c;text-decoration:underline;}
#drop_menu_products_clicked{color:#cf003c;font-weight:bold;padding-left:10px;}

#drop_menu_news{position:absolute;z-index:100;top:28px;left:225px;background: #000;font-weight:bold;width:115px;font-family:arial;font-size:11px;display:none;}
#drop_menu_news a{color:#fff;padding-left:10px;text-decoration:none;line-height:25px;}
#drop_menu_news a:hover{color:#cf003c;text-decoration:underline;}
#drop_menu_news_clicked{color:#cf003c;font-weight:bold;padding-left:10px;line-height:25px;}

p{text-indent:20px;padding-left:5px;padding-right:5px;}

td{width:210px; border-bottom:1px solid#000;}

#background1{position:relative;float:right;margin-right:0px;width:206px;height:76px;border:0px;background: url(images/savoury_background1.jpg) top right no-repeat;}
#background2{clear:both;position:relative;float:right;margin-right:0px;width:341px;height:191px;border:0px;background: url(images/savoury_background2.jpg) top right no-repeat;}
#background3{clear:both;position:relative;float:right;margin-right:0px;width:364px;height:206px;border:0px;background: url(images/savoury_background3.jpg) top right no-repeat;}
#background4{clear:both;position:relative;float:right;margin-right:0px;width:206px;height:63px;border:0px;background: url(images/savoury_background4.jpg) top right no-repeat;}

#sweet_background1{clear:both;position:relative;float:right;margin-right:0px;width:235px;height:107px;border:0px;background: url(images/sweet_background1.jpg) top right no-repeat;}
#sweet_background2{clear:both;position:relative;float:right;margin-right:0px;width:321px;height:317px;border:0px;background: url(images/sweet_background2.jpg) top right no-repeat;}
#sweet_background3{clear:both;position:relative;float:right;margin-right:0px;width:295px;height:112px;border:0px;background: url(images/sweet_background3.jpg) top right no-repeat;}

input,textarea,select {display: block;width:150px;float:left; border:1px solid #979797;margin-bottom: 3px;margin-left:30px;}
label{display: block;width:170px;float: left;text-align:right;margin-bottom: 7px; }
br {clear: left;}
.button{display:block;width:70px;margin-left:200px;color:#fff;background:#cf003c;height:23px;border:0px;}

.table_stockists { margin-left:80px; text-align:left;margin-top:10px;}

.table_stockists td{width:300px;border:0px;}


.trade_table{border:2px solid #000;  text-align:center;margin-left:20px; width:714px;margin:15px;}
.trade_table td{border:1px solid #000;  text-align:center;}